| Дата: Среда, 18.02.2015, 18:07 | Сообщение # 1 |
|
|
Сообщений: | 35 |
Клан: | |Gum-Gang| |
Награды: | 1 |
0
|
| Интересует такой вопрос какая из строк влияет на размер прицела??? WeaponData { "MaxPlayerSpeed" "261" "WeaponType" "Pistol" "WeaponPrice" "650" "WeaponArmorRatio" "1.35" "CrosshairMinDistance" "4" "CrosshairDeltaDistance" "1" "Team" "ANY" "BuiltRightHanded" "0" "PlayerAnimationExtension" "pistol" "MuzzleFlashScale" "1.2" "CanEquipWithShield" "1" // Weapon characteristics: "Penetration" "1" "Damage" "42" "Range" "4196" "RangeModifier" "0.96" "Bullets" "1" "CycleTime" "0.35" // Weapon data is loaded by both the Game and Client DLLs. "printname" "#Cstrike_WPNHUD_DesertEagle" "viewmodel" "models/weapons/v_pist_deagle.mdl" "playermodel" "models/weapons/w_pist_deagle.mdl" "shieldviewmodel" "models/weapons/v_shield_de_r.mdl" "anim_prefix" "anim" "bucket" "1" "bucket_position" "1"
"clip_size" "6" "primary_ammo" "BULLET_PLAYER_50AE" "secondary_ammo" "None"
"weight" "7" "item_flags" "0" // Sounds for the weapon. There is a max of 16 sounds per category (i.e. max 16 "single_shot" sounds) SoundData { //"reload" "Default.Reload" //"empty" "Default.ClipEmpty_Rifle" "single_shot" "Weapon_DEagle.Single" }
// Weapon Sprite data is loaded by the Client DLL. TextureData { "weapon" { "font" "CSweaponsSmall" "character" "F" } "weapon_s" { "font" "CSweapons" "character" "F" } "ammo" { "font" "CSTypeDeath" "character" "U" } "crosshair" { "file" "sprites/crosshairs" "x" "0" "y" "48" "width" "24" "height" "24" } "autoaim" { "file" "sprites/crosshairs" "x" "0" "y" "48" "width" "24" "height" "24" } } ModelBounds { Viewmodel { Mins "-7 -3 -14" Maxs "19 10 -2" } World { Mins "-1 -3 -2" Maxs "13 4 6" } } }
|
|
|
|
| Дата: Среда, 18.02.2015, 18:41 | Сообщение # 2 |
|
|
Сообщений: | 42 |
Награды: | 17 |
335
|
| Макс игрока Speed261 Оружие типа "пистолет" "Оружие цена" "650" "Оружие Броня Ratio" "1,35" "Crosshair Минимальное расстояние" "4" "Crosshair Delta Расстояние" "1" "Команда" "ЛЮБОЙ" "Встроенный Правша" "0" "Игрок Анимация Расширение" "пистолет" "Морда вспышка Масштаб" "1,2"
"Можно оборудовать с экраном" "1"
// Оружие характеристики: "Проникновение" "1" "Ущерб" "42" "Диапазон" "4196" "Диапазон Модификатор" "0,96" "Пули", "1" "Время цикла" "0,35"
Оружие данные загружаются как игры и клиентских библиотек DLL. "Имя печать" "#Cstrike_WPNHUD_DesertEagle" "Модель представления" "модели / оружие / v_pist_deagle.mdl" "модель игрока" "модели / оружие / w_pist_deagle.mdl" "Посмотреть щит модель" "модели / оружие / v_shield_de_r.mdl" "anim_prefix" "Анимация" "ковша", "1" "Положение ведро" "1"
Размер клипа "6"
"первичный боеприпасы" "BULLET_PLAYER_50AE" "не вторичный боеприпасы" "Нет"
"вес" "7" "предмет флаги" "0"
// Звуки для оружия. Существует не более 16 звуков в категории (то есть не более 16 "single_shot" звуков) звуковых данных { // "перезагрузить" "Default.Reload" // "пустой" "Default.ClipEmpty_Rifle" "один выстрел" "Weapon_DEagle.Single" }
// Данные оружие Sprite загружается DLL клиента. TextureData { "оружие" { "шрифт" "CSweaponsSmall" "характер" "F" } "оружие S" { "Шрифт", "CSweapons" "характер" "F" } "боеприпасы" { "шрифт" "CSTypeDeath" "характер", "У" } "перекрестие" { "Файл" "спрайты / перекрестье" "X", "0" "Y", "48" "ширина" "24" "Высота" "24" } "Авто целью" { "Файл" "спрайты / перекрестье" "X", "0" "Y", "48" "ширина" "24" "Высота" "24" } } Модель Границы { Посмотреть модель { Мин "-7 -3 -14" Maxs "19 10 -2" } мир { Мин "-1 -3 -2" MAXS "13 4 6" } } }
|
|
|
|
| Дата: Пятница, 27.03.2015, 16:01 | Сообщение # 3 |
|
|
Сообщений: | 35 |
Клан: | |Gum-Gang| |
Награды: | 1 |
0
|
| Все разобрался СПАСИБО!Добавлено (27.03.2015, 15:01) --------------------------------------------- Эта статья расскажет вам о модифицировании параметров оружия в Counter-Strike:Source. Пошагово рассматривается весь процесс от экспорта до конечного просмотра в игре.Подготовка к рабoтеДля работы нам нужно следующее: - программа CtxConverter для расшифровки скриптов.
- распакованная из .gcf архивов папка Scripts (в пиратских копиях игра уже распакована).
- программа GcfScape для распаковки .gcf архивов (владельцам пираток программа не нужна)
- прямые руки
- надо создать на локальном диске C папку Scripts
Интерфейс CtxConverterИнтерфейс прогаммы довльно прост: Все функции осуществляются кнопками Open Ctx и Convert, первая отвечает за выбор нужного скрита, вторая же компилирует и декомпилирует скрипты. Снизу расположен лог действий. Также программа может декомпилировать скрипты от Half Life 2: DeathMatchи Day of Defeat: Source, для использования этих функций просто воспользуйтесь полями, которые находятся ниже Counter Strike Source.Начало работыИтак, вы создали директорию Scripts на локальном диске С. Вам следует скопировать содержимое папки Scripts из CSS в созданную вами папку. Теперь мы можем запустить непосредственно саму программу. Жмем на кнопку Open Ctx, затем выбираем нужное нам оружие из той самой папки, я, например, выбрал weapon_m249.ctx (пулемет, по умолчанию покупается сочетанием клавиш B51). Жмем на кнопку Convert, и спустя несколько секунд в директории C:/Scripts/ появится файл weapon_m249.txtИзменение параметров оружияДля начала редактирования, нам нужно открыть полученный файл в блокноте. После декомпиляции скрипт стал отображатся нормально, и теперь мы можем его отредактировать. Привожу список функций и их значения:- MaxPlayerSpeed - Определяет максимальную скорость игрока при ношении оружия.
- WeaponType - Тип оружия, бывают вида Knife, Pistol, Rifle, Submachine gun, Machine gun, Rifle, Sniper Rifle. С помощью этой функции вы можете, например, перенести AWP в слот для ножа, и т.д. Кстати, если оружию типа Sniper Rifle поставить тип Rifle, то вы получите такойже зум, но без черной маски вокруг.
- WeaponPrice - цена оружия, не рекомендую ставить значение больше чем 16000, иначе оружие нельзя будет купить.
- Team - очень важная функция, управляет возможностью закупки той или иной командой оружия. Например, если при редактировании меню покупок (допустим, вы решили добавитьAK47 в меню покупок CT) вы предварительно не установите для AK47 в этой функции значение ANY, то оружие будет невозможно купить.
- PlayerAnimationExtension - можно изменить анимацию держания оружия, в основном ненужная функция.
- Penetration - простреливаемость объектов оружием (например, ворота на карте de_dust).
- Damage - урон оружия, думаю с ним итак все понятно.
- Range - радиус разлета пуль, чем он меньше, тем больше вероятность попадания.
- Bullets - количество пуль, выпускаемое оружием, каждая выпущенная пуля несет кол-во урона, равное функции Damage, яркий тому пример - дробовик, каждая попавшая из него пуля наносит по 22 единицы урона.
- CycleTime - скорострельноть оружия, чем ниже значение, тем быстрее стреляет оружие.
- Printname - Название оружия, показывается при выборе оржия, если в опциях игры не установлена галочка "быстрая смена оружия".
- Viewmodel, Playermodel - пути к моделям оружия, можно использовать для подстановки моделей, не заменяющих оригинальные.
- Clip_size - Максимальное кол-во заряженных патронов (при установке значений выше 300 будет лаг с надписью, но на самом деле патронов будет столько, сколько указано в скрипте).
- Primary_ammo, Secondary_ammo - патроны для оружия, отображаются возле их количества.
- Weight - вес оружия.
Теперь, зная значения большинства функций, вы можете отредактировать любое оружие по своему вкусу. После окончания работы пересохраните файл.Завершающая часть работыИтак, оружие отредактированию, теперь главная задача - внедрить его в игру, для этого вновь откроем CtxConverter. Теперь выбираем уже отредактированный файл со скриптом оружия (кнопка Open TXT), в моем случае это C:/scripts/weapon_m249.txt. Жмем кнопку Convert. CTXскрипт, ранее лежащий в C:/Scripts/, заменится свежесозданным. Предварительно сделав бэкап заменяемых файлов, копируем этот свежесозданный скрипт в .../CSS/cstrike/scripts/. Все, работа закончена, можно запускать игру и тестировать.P.S. Сетевая игра работает только если файлы у сервера и клиента идентичны, например, чтобы поиграть с другом через Garena, вашему другу следует установить в свой CSS вашу папку _.../cstrike/scripts/. Если файлы будут раличны, вас банально не пустит на сервер.Вот скриншот с отредактированным weapon_m249.ctx, теперь в него заряжается 360 патронов, бешенная скорострельность, однако у вас понижается скорость передвижения, и радиус разлета пуль очень большой. Я приложил этот самый .ctx к статье. Также еще пара
|
|
|
|